CAPITAL MARKET

Page 3: Capital market and primary market

Markets for buying and selling equity and debt instruments. Capital markets channel savings and investment between suppliers of capital such as retail investors and institutional investors, and users of capital like businesses, government and individuals.

Capital markets are vital to the functioning of an economy, since capital is a critical component for generating economic output.

Capital markets include primary markets, where new stock and bond issues are sold to investors, and secondary markets, which trade existing securities.

Ctnd.Primary Market provides the channel for sale of new securities

and also for the new companies to enter into the share market and make their mark.

These shares are issued in both domestic and international markets and is a channel for the companies to meet their financial requirements.

FEATURES OF PRIMARY MARKETFeatures of primary markets include: The securities are issued by the company directly to the

investors. The company receives the money and issues new securities to

the investors. The primary markets are used by companies for the purpose

of setting up new ventures/ business or for expanding or modernizing the

existing business .Primary market performs the crucial function of facilitating

capital formation in the economy .

PROSPECTUSA disclosure document that describes a

financial security for potential buyers. It commonly provides investors with material information about the securities being issued. As per the section 56 of the companies act all the contents of the prospectus should be disclosed in a fair and unbiased manner.

Players in new issue market• ISSUER: The corporation, municipality, government

agency or investment company offering securities for sale to investors.

• UNDERWRITER: An investment bank that serves as intermediary between the issuer and the investing public.

• SYNDICATE: A group of investment banks which jointly underwrite and distribute an offering.

• REGISTRARS: They maintain the dematerialised application for new issues,their cheques,stock invests etc., and work under the stipulations of SEBI and RBI rules

Types of issues in a capital marketPublic issue : when a company raises funds by

selling its shares to the public through issue of offer document it is called public issue.

– Initial public offering: when a unlisted company makes a public issue for the first time and gets its shares listed on stock exchange.

– Further public offering: when a listed company makes another public issue to raise capital through an offer document.

Right issue: when an existing company wants to raise additional capital, securities are offered to the existing shareholders on a pre-emptive basis.

Preferential issue: this is an issue of shares by listed companies to a selected group of persons(u/s 81 of companies act 1956)

Functions of primary market• The main function of a new issue market is to facilitate

transfer of resources from savers to the users. The savers

are individuals, commercial banks, insurance

companies etc. The users are public limited companies

and the government. It is not only a platform for raising

finance to establish new enterprises but also for

expansion/ diversification/ modernization of existing

units.

Functions of new issue market

Page 14: Capital market and primary market

Origination: It refers to the work of investigation, analysis and processing

of new project proposals. It starts before an issue is actually floated in the

market. This function is done by merchant bankers who may be commercial

banks. At present, financial institutions and private firms also perform this

service. Though this service is highly important, the success of the issue

depends on the efficiency of the market

Underwriting: It is an agreement whereby the underwriter promises

to subscribe to a specified number of shares or debentures or a specified

amount of stock in the event of public not subscribing to the issue. If the issue is

fully subscribed, then there is no liability for the underwriter. If a part of share

issues remains unsold, the  underwriter will buy the shares. Thus, underwriting is

a guarantee for marketability of shares. There are two types of underwriters in

India - Institutional ( LIC, UTI, IDBI, ICICI) and Non-institutional are brokers.

Distribution: It is the function of sale of securities to ultimate investors. This

service is performed by brokers and agents who maintain a regular and direct

contact with the ultimate investors.
